Junior Python Developer

Abu Dhabi Tax Free5 days agoFull-time External
189.3k - 9.5m / yr
Job Description Are you passionate about software development and eager to kickstart your career in technology? We are seeking a motivated Junior Python Developer to join our dynamic team. As a Junior Python Developer, you will have the opportunity to work alongside experienced developers to build and maintain robust web applications and APIs, troubleshoot and diagnose software issues, and contribute to innovative projects. You will apply your coding skills in Python to develop scalable software solutions while gaining invaluable experience in a collaborative environment. If you are enthusiastic about learning new technologies and enjoy problem-solving, this role is perfect for you. Join us and be part of a team that values your growth and professional development. Responsibilities Collaborate with senior developers to design and implement software solutions.Write clean, efficient, and scalable Python code for various applications.Participate in code reviews to ensure coding standards and best practices.Assist in the development of user-friendly web interfaces and tools.Debug, troubleshoot, and resolve software defects and issues as they arise.Contribute to the improvement of existing software applications and systems.Document software functionalities and processes for future reference.Stay updated with emerging technologies and frameworks in the Python ecosystem.Collaborate with cross-functional teams to gather and analyze technical requirements.Test and validate applications to ensure optimal performance and quality.Support the deployment of software projects and maintenance of systems. Requirements Bachelor s degree in Computer Science or a related technical field is preferred.Basic understanding of Python programming language and its applications.Familiarity with web frameworks such as Django or Flask is a plus.Problem-solving skills with the ability to think critically and analytically.Experience with basic version control systems, such as Git, is desirable.Good communication and teamwork skills to collaborate effectively with others.Eagerness to learn and ability to adapt to new technologies and tools.